WebFAMILY AND KIN. Dominican Republic Table of Contents. The family was the fundamental social unit. It provided a bulwark in the midst of political upheavals and economic reversals. People emphasized the trust, the assistance, and the solidarity that kin owed to one another. Family loyalty was an ingrained and unquestioned virtue; from … WebRepresentative Democracy.
